import { Button, Icon, Modal, DialogTrigger, Dialog, Text, useToast } from '@umami/react-zen'; import { Icons } from '@/components/icons'; import { useMessages, useModified } from '@/components/hooks'; import { TeamAddForm } from './TeamAddForm'; import { messages } from '@/components/messages'; export function TeamsAddButton({ onSave }: { onSave?: () => void }) { const { formatMessage, labels } = useMessages(); const { toast } = useToast(); const { touch } = useModified(); const handleSave = async () => { toast(formatMessage(messages.saved)); touch('teams'); onSave?.(); }; return ( {({ close }) => } ); }